Transaction 38a3151088e54cbfaf91fd91f764d1678a6830cbe0d8f9d713f36e76eadb0cbc

1 Input
1 Outputs
  • 38a3151088e54cbfaf91fd91f764d1678a6830cbe0d8f9d713f36e76eadb0cbc:0
  • value  102988
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G